The San Francisco Rock Project was born in June of 2010, when a group of local families and teacher/musicians banded together to form a nonprofit music school. Thanks to countless hours logged by its many volunteers, a deeply talented and dedicated staff, and a hard-working gifted group of students, SF Rock Project quickly established its presence as a premier rock-based music school in the Bay Area.
Rock Project is proud to be a nonprofit corporation, with all proceeds being returned to the program in the form of scholarships and tuition assistance, equipment and facilities maintenance, and staff compensation.
